Oil Absorption Efficiency

Have you noticed how some powders keep your T-zone matte all day? They work because of their oil absorption ability. Good powders quickly soak up extra oil when you apply them. This stops shine from appearing. Powders with tiny, fine particles have more surface area. They trap oil better, acting like small sponges. Ingredients like silica, mineral clays, or sugar polymers increase this effect. They give you a matte finish that lasts. Powders free of talc and rich in minerals are gentler. They help prevent clogged pores. To make powders work even better, press and tap them onto your face. Do not wipe or swipe. This boosts their oil-absorbing power. Use these powders to keep your T-zone shine-free and confident all day.

Skin Compatibility

Choosing the right setting powder matters. Pick a powder that controls shine but is gentle on your skin. Look for products labeled non-comedogenic, which do not clog pores. Avoid powders with heavy ingredients like talc or mineral oils, as these can cause breakouts. Choose hypoallergenic formulas without artificial fragrances or dyes to reduce skin irritation. Select lightweight, breathable textures that do not feel heavy or cakey. Make sure the powder’s pH balance matches your skin’s natural level. This helps keep your skin healthy and balanced. Use these tips to find a powder that keeps your skin looking fresh and matte all day.

Shade Match Options

Choosing the right setting powder shade is important for a perfect finish. A good shade blends smoothly with your skin, making your makeup look natural and shine-free. Translucent powders work best for a barely-there finish, but they can look ashy on darker skin if not formulated well. Tinted powders in pink or yellow can brighten dull skin and reduce discoloration. Always test the powder in natural light before buying. Pick a shade close to your skin color or slightly lighter for a fresh, vibrant look.

Formulation Ingredients

To keep your T-zone matte and fresh all day, focus on ingredients that control oil. Look for powders with silica, kaolin, or sugar polymers. These ingredients absorb excess sebum without adding heaviness. Mineral and cotton extracts help create a matte finish and soothe skin. Avoid products with heavy talc and synthetic fragrances. These can clog pores or cause irritation, especially if you have sensitive or acne-prone skin. Choose formulas with long-lasting, oil-controlling ingredients. These stay effective through busy days. Making smart ingredient choices helps your skin look matte and feel comfortable.

Frequently Asked Questions

How Often Should I Reapply Setting Powder During the Day?

You should reapply setting powder every 4 to 6 hours, especially if you notice shine reappearing. Carry a small amount with you for quick touch-ups, and gently press it onto your skin to keep your makeup fresh and matte.

Can Setting Powders Cause Clogged Pores or Breakouts?

Setting powders can clog pores or cause breakouts if you don’t choose non-comedogenic formulas or if you apply too much. To avoid issues, keep your skin clean, and remove makeup thoroughly at day’s end.

Are There Any Setting Powders Suitable for Sensitive Skin?

Yes, there are gentle, sensitive-skin-friendly setting powders made from soft, non-irritating ingredients like mineral or rice powder. You can try translucent options designed for delicate skin, and always patch-test new products to avoid reactions.

How Do I Prevent My Makeup From Looking Cakey With Powder?

To prevent your makeup from looking cakey with powder, use a light hand, opt for a translucent or finely milled powder, and apply sparingly with a damp sponge or brush, blending gently for a smooth, natural finish.

Can Setting Powder Be Used to Control Oil on Other Face Areas?

Yes, you can use setting powder on other face areas to control oil. Apply it lightly with a brush or sponge, focusing on oily zones like your cheeks and chin, for a matte finish and longer-lasting makeup.
